Durability
The natural leather is that it can withstand wear and tear better than sofas made of fabric which makes it the more durable option for busy households. While some think that it is more expensive, it's actually the opposite - the longevity of leather lounges will save you money over the long term as you won't have to buy an entire new one as often. Furthermore, quality leather will be able to withstand spills and other accidents much more easily than fabric, provided it is treated with appropriate care products.
This can be beneficial for certain, but it could cause problems for those with pets or young children. spills, stains and pet odors are sure to occur. You'll need a sofa that is easy to clean and resistant to smells. Smoke can be difficult for a sofa to remove when you live in a house where smoking is common.
When purchasing a sofa made of fabric make sure you choose a fiber that has enhanced qualities like stain resistance. It's also worth looking for furniture with a strong frame, especially if it's going to be used in a busy family home. The best frames are constructed from hardwoods like Ash, Maple or Oak. A cheaper option would be to opt for furniture-grade plywood that has joints that are double dowelled screwed and glued. Even better is mortise and Tenon construction, which increases the strength of the frame.

Style
The sofa is a focal point in many living rooms and can have a significant impact on the overall appearance of your space. When it comes to picking the right sofa, there are many aspects to take into consideration, including comfort, frame construction and filling material, as well as style. There are a variety of options to choose from, whether you want leather or fabric sofas.
Leather is a popular material for sofas, which adds elegance and luxurious to your living space. It's versatile and durable with a wide range of colors available. Leather is easy to clean, making it is a great choice for families with pets or children. However, it is important to keep in mind that leather is more expensive than other sofa materials.
Fabric sofas can be less expensive than leather and come in a variety of patterns and colors that will match your interior decor. They are also easy to clean and can be brushed or vacuumed to remove dust and dirt. However, it's important to remember that a fabric sofa is more prone to odours and staining, than a leather sofa.
When selecting a 2 seater couch, ensure that it fits the interior design of your house. A sleek and modern design is a good fit for a modern living space, whereas a more traditional style is suitable for formal settings. Also, make sure that the sofa you choose to purchase fits the dimensions of your living space.
A two-seater sofa should offer the comfort needed for long durations. It should offer good lumbar and armrest support and be firm enough to provide a comfortable sitting experience. It should be equipped with a removable cover so that you can wash it in the event of need.
